Output 8d65645d681495575cb320e510a9a084d44c1908424e21b86ded07b4e7a5e22a:0

value
94788800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4752e372942ca3681f10f15289c03e053b87bed5 OP_EQUALVERIFY OP_CHECKSIG
address
17W8Gp5HT1drSm6skuPuxiWgvvizzmTSJa
transaction
8d65645d681495575cb320e510a9a084d44c1908424e21b86ded07b4e7a5e22a
confirmations
158011
spent
true